Question

Using dbaccess via SSH into a fedora server. When I go to Query - New, both backspace and delete do not have an effect.

How can I set up the environment to work with delete/backspace? They work fine in vi.

Edit: Some more info. CTRL-H in vi deletes the previous characer (same as backspace). CTRL-H in dbaccess moves the cursor left one character but does not delete anything.

Solution

Finally found the solution! I was using Putty, and the default settings under Terminal-Keyboard was Control-? (127) for backspace. When I set this to Control-H, the cursor in DBAccess goes left one character. It does not remove the character, but this is better than doing nothing at all.
